Why These Are the Top Pest Control Contractors in Westernport

** The pest control market in and around Westernport, MD, is characteristic of a rural region. There are very few, if any, standalone pest control companies physically headquartered within the town limits. Consequently, the market is served by reputable companies based in larger regional hubs such as Cumberland, Frostburg, and Hagerstown, with some larger regional players like American Pest extending their service radius from Frederick. The competition level is moderate, with a mix of long-standing local family businesses and established regional franchises. This provides residents with a good range of choices from personalized local service to companies with extensive resources and guarantees. Service quality is generally high among the top-rated providers, as they rely on strong reputations and word-of-mouth in close-knit communities. Typical pricing is competitive. A standard one-time treatment for common insects (ants, spiders) can range from **$150 - $350**. Ongoing quarterly preventative plans typically cost **$100 - $200 per quarter**. Specialized services like termite treatment (often requiring tenting and liquid barriers) or wildlife removal are more significant investments, commonly ranging from **$1,200 to $3,500+** depending on the severity of the infestation and the size of the property. Most top providers offer free inspections and quotes.

1What are the most common pest problems for homeowners in Westernport, MD, and when should I be most vigilant?

Due to Westernport's humid continental climate and proximity to the Potomac River and wooded areas, common pests include rodents (mice, rats), ants (including carpenter ants), stinging insects (wasps, yellowjackets), and occasional termite pressure. Seasonal vigilance is key: rodents seek shelter in fall/winter, ants and stinging insects are active spring through summer, and moisture-loving pests like centipedes or silverfish can be a year-round concern in damp basements.

3Are there any local regulations or environmental considerations in Westernport that affect pest control treatments?

Yes. All pest control companies must be licensed by the Maryland Department of Agriculture (MDA). Furthermore, being in the Chesapeake Bay watershed, reputable companies will use targeted, Integrated Pest Management (IPM) strategies to minimize broad pesticide use and runoff. Special care is taken near waterways like the Potomac River, and some treatments for pests like mosquitoes may have additional county-level guidelines in Allegany County.

5I've heard about termites in Maryland. Is my home in Westernport at risk, and what are the signs?

Yes, subterranean termites are active throughout Maryland, including Westernport. The region's soil and climate support their colonies. Key signs include mud tubes on foundation walls, discarded wings near windowsills, hollow-sounding wood, and frass (termite droppings). Given the risk, an annual professional inspection is strongly recommended, especially for older homes or those with wood-to-soil contact, as damage is often hidden.
